Fall Festival Takes Place Along Dequindre Cut In Detroit

DETROIT (AP) — A fall festival featuring Halloween activities is taking place along the Dequindre Cut Greenway in Detroit.

"Harvestfest in the D" is Saturday afternoon, with free and family-friendly activities, airbrush tattoos, hayrides and trick-or-treating.

The event near the Dequindre Cut's Gratiot Street entrance is hosted by the Detroit RiverFront Conservancy, Eastern Market and the City of Detroit Department of Neighborhoods.

Dan Carmody, president of Eastern Market Corp., says in a statement the event "brings the fall activities kids enjoy on farms all over Michigan down to the heart of the Detroit."

Meanwhile, Detroit plans to host Halloween trick-or-treating along Woodward Avenue in downtown on Oct. 31. The city says details were being finalized.
